Rugby Australia Unveils 2024 Super W Fixture with Streamlined Women's Progression Pathway

Rugby Australia has revealed the schedule for the 2024 Super W season, featuring 12 double-headers and additional Super Rugby Pacific fixtures in Australia and Fiji. The season opener will see the NSW Waratahs facing the ACT Brumbies at Allianz Stadium, while the Fijian Drua, previously known as Fijiana, will take on the Queensland Reds in a Grand Final rematch, marking the start of their pursuit for a treble championship.

The top four teams will progress to the semi-finals, with the Grand Final slated for the final weekend of April. To prepare for the season, teams will engage in three weeks of official pre-season matches, including matchups against Oceania and Japan hosted by Australia.

Rugby Australia has also introduced the Super Rugby Women's U19 competition and integrated the Next Generation Sevens into the Super Rugby Women's Sevens program, offering a simplified pathway to women's sevens rugby.

Rugby Australia's CEO, Phil Waugh, expressed, "The 2024 Super W draw ensures that we will showcase the incredible talents of women's rugby players from Australia and Fiji to a diverse audience. Alongside the substantial growth in women's rugby sevens and fifteens at the grassroots level, the future of women's rugby in Australia looks exceedingly promising."

While the aspiration is to expand the Super W tournament, Waugh emphasized that such expansion would require reallocation of funds from other areas of the Women's Rugby program. Rugby Australia is committed to the thoughtful and strategic growth of women's rugby, and more details about their upcoming plans will be shared soon.
